Lord of the Rings: Gollum

A familiar story from a different perspectiv­e.

An air of mystery has surrounded The Lord of the Rings: Gollum ever since it was announced by Daedalic back in March 2019. The studio has outlined its grand vision for the game: to tell the story of the destructio­n of the One Ring from the perspectiv­e of Gollum, rather than the Fellowship.

But now, finally, I get to see the game in action, and get a sense of how it might actually play. Alas, it’s a hands-off demo, and the developer playing it says the build is ten months old. So I’m not getting a totally accurate picture of what the finished game will be like.

Gollum has been imprisoned in Barad-dûr, the colossal tower built by Sauron in the fiery heart of Mordor. The Dark Lord’s stronghold looks massive from the perspectiv­e of the diminutive former hobbit. Luckily he’s an expert climber.

The developer controllin­g the demo notes that Gollum has been clambering around Middle-earth for around 500 years, and has developed superhuman strength and climbing skills as a result.

He can run on walls, swing on poles, slide down cliffs, and crawl up certain surfaces. He may be a wretched monster tormented by the power of the One Ring, but he’s very nimble on his feet.

In the build I’m shown, Gollum’s animations are in pretty rough shape. I watch him scramble around Barad-dûr, and it feels very… placeholde­r. There are no smooth transition­s between his various

states – running, climbing and swinging – which makes it look stiff and robotic.

Gollum is trying to reach the immense gate that leads out of the tower. There’s no map screen or minimap in the game, so you have to pay close attention to the environmen­t to find a way your way there. At one point Gollum acquires a handdrawn map scribbled by an orc, but as you might expect, it’s not that easy to read.

The scale and detail of the tower is impressive. It’s all jagged obsidian spires and snaking rivers of bubbling lava, which is exactly the kind of interior decoration you’d expect from an edgelord like Sauron.

Daedalic says its approach to level design in the game will give players a lot of freedom. There will, apparently, be multiple ways to get through an area, which I get a sense of as I see Gollum picking a route through Barad-dûr.

Gollum is not a fighter, meaning stealth plays a prominent role in the game. Another of his abilities is having a keen sense of hearing – especially in the dark.

MY PRECIOUS

This wasn’t implemente­d in the demo I saw, but in the finished game you’ll be able to see sounds, helping you find enemies and predict their movements. If you manage to isolate a lone orc, Gollum can knock them out – but this takes a long time and generates a lot of noise.

One of the most interestin­g things about Gollum is the raging internal battle between his current self and Sméagol, the hobbit he used to be before the ring polluted his mind. At certain points in the game you’re forced to make a choice, deciding whether to react to something as the violent, bitter, duplicitou­s Gollum, or the meek, kindly Sméagol.

It’s an intriguing concept, but I was thrown off a bit by the portrayal of the character. This game is based purely on the books – as a fan of the films I struggled a bit with hearing someone other than Serkis performing the role.

That’s gonna take some getting used to. But Daedalic has promised that it will remain faithful to the source material, which means we might not see anything as egregious as ShadowofWa­r’s bizarrely sexy Shelob here.
